How do charities receive donations?
We partner exclusively with PayPal Giving Fund to benefit charities in the United States, Australia, Canada and the United Kingdom. PayPal Giving Fund receives donations and grants donated funds to benefiting charities, based on their policies and terms in eligible countries.

How do taxes work?
Donations to US 501(c)(3) non-profits are typically tax-deductible. Donations to charities outside the US may be eligible for tax credits or deductions.
If you have questions about the deductibility of any donations, please contact a tax professional.

How do fees work?
Meta no longer covers donation payment processing fees in the United States, Australia, Canada and the United Kingdom. All donations in those countries will now incur a payment processing fee from a third-party payment processing partner. Donors will have the option to increase their donations to cover fees.

Are my donations eligible for Gift Aid?
If you are a UK taxpayer donating to a charity registered in the UK, your donation could be eligible for Gift Aid.
